What is Cloudflare?

Editorial review
Cloudflare is a global cloud platform for security, performance, and reliability. CDN delivers content from cities worldwide. DDoS protection and WAF secure websites and APIs. Workers run serverless code at the edge. DNS, domains, and email routing included. The internet's nervous system that makes websites fast and secure.

Is Cloudflare worth the price?

90/100

Cloudflare's Free plan is the most generous in the CDN industry, unlimited bandwidth, DDoS protection, and a global CDN at $0.

The Pro plan at $20/domain/month is excellent value for small businesses needing WAF and image optimization. But Cloudflare's real revenue comes from its developer platform: Workers, R2, Pages, Stream, and Images are billed usage-based and can add up fast at scale.

The key insight is that Cloudflare is two products, a CDN/security layer (simple per-domain pricing) and a developer platform (complex usage-based pricing). Most sites only need the first, and for that, Cloudflare is unbeatable on value.

Enterprise at $3,000+/month is where costs jump, but you get a dedicated solutions engineer and SLA.

Hidden Costs & Gotchas

Workers usage-based billing

$5/month base + $0.30/million requests beyond 10M included + $0.02/million CPU milliseconds beyond 30M. A high-traffic API handling 100M requests/month costs $5 base + $27 requests + CPU time = $50-$100/month

R2 storage

$0.015/GB/month is cheap (no egress fees), but Class A operations (writes/deletes) cost $4.50/million. A write-heavy application doing 50M writes/month costs $225/month in operations alone, despite cheap storage

Stream video

$5/1K minutes stored + $1/1K minutes delivered. A platform with 100K minutes stored and 500K minutes delivered/month costs $500 storage + $500 delivery = $1,000/month

Images

$5/100K images stored + $1/100K images delivered. An e-commerce site with 500K product images and 5M deliveries/month costs $25 storage + $50 delivery = $75/month

Workers KV at scale

reads are cheap ($0.50/million beyond 10M), but writes are $5.00/million beyond 1M. A cache-heavy app with 10M writes/month costs $45/month in KV writes

D1 database

rows written cost $1.00/million beyond 50M included. A database-heavy app writing 500M rows/month costs $450/month

Argo Smart Routing

$5/month base + $0.10/GB of data transfer. Improves latency 30% but adds a per-GB cost on top of the free bandwidth promise

Load Balancing

starts at $5/month per origin pool. Multi-region setups with health checks can cost $15-$50/month

Log Explorer

$1/GB ingested after first 10 GB free. Enterprise-level logging at 1 TB/month = $990/month

Enterprise pricing is opaque

starts at $3,000/month but varies widely based on traffic, security needs, and add-ons. Some enterprises pay $10,000-$50,000/month

Cloudflare FAQ

How does Cloudflare enhance website performance?

Cloudflare acts as a global cloud platform that significantly improves website performance. Its Content Delivery Network (CDN) delivers content from over 310 cities worldwide, ensuring faster load times for users by serving data from the nearest location.

Which teams benefit most from Cloudflare?

Teams focused on web operations, security, and development will find Cloudflare most beneficial. It provides tools for securing websites and APIs, accelerating content delivery, and running serverless code at the edge, addressing critical needs across these functions.

How is Cloudflare priced?

Cloudflare is available on a free tier, offering essential services without cost. For users requiring more extensive features, higher usage limits, or advanced capabilities, paid plans are available to meet those needs.

What kind of security does Cloudflare provide for websites?

Cloudflare offers robust security features including DDoS protection and a Web Application Firewall (WAF). These services are designed to secure websites and APIs against various online threats, safeguarding them from malicious attacks.

Can Cloudflare be used for serverless application development?

Yes, Cloudflare supports serverless application development through its Workers feature. This allows developers to run serverless code directly at the edge, enabling faster execution and reduced latency for their applications.

How does Cloudflare compare to Akamai for content delivery?

Cloudflare, like Akamai, offers a robust Content Delivery Network (CDN) to improve content delivery. Cloudflare's CDN distributes content from over 310 cities globally, contributing to its reputation for great performance and a free CDN tier.

What are the trade-offs when implementing Cloudflare?

While Cloudflare offers significant benefits, users might find its advanced features to be complex. This complexity can present a learning curve for those looking to leverage its full suite of capabilities beyond the basic offerings.
